Summary
Predicted to enable structural molecule activity. Predicted to be located in intermediate filament. Is expressed in several structures, including EVL; cardiovascular system; gall bladder; head; and pronephric duct. Human ortholog(s) of this gene implicated in liver cirrhosis. Orthologous to human KRT18 (keratin 18). [provided by Alliance of Genome Resources, Apr 2022]
